The Top 5 Arcade Games of the 1990s, Ranked

Arcade games weren't exactly at their peak in the 1990s, but the decade still delivered some unforgettable coin-operated classics. While home consoles like the PlayStation and Nintendo 64 dominated living rooms, arcades fought back with bigger screens, better sound, and unique experiences you could not get at home. Here are the five best arcade games from the 1990s, ranked.

5. House of the Dead (1996)
Sega's light-gun shooter brought zombie-killing chaos to arcades. Players used a plastic gun to blast through hordes of undead, with cheesy voice acting and branching paths that kept each playthrough fresh. It was simple, gory fun that drew crowds.

4. Marvel vs. Capcom (1998)
This fighting game mashed up comic book heroes with Capcom characters like Ryu and Mega Man. The fast-paced tag-team battles and over-the-top special moves made it a staple in arcades. The vibrant sprites and chaotic action still hold up today.

3. Daytona USA (1993)
Sega's racing game was all about speed and that unforgettable "Daytona" theme song. With force-feedback steering wheels and smooth 3D graphics for its time, it let players race at 200 miles per hour in a cabinet that shook with every turn. It was a must-play for any arcade visit.

2. Street Fighter II: The World Warrior (1991)
Capcom's fighting game changed arcades forever. With a roster of eight unique characters, each with special moves, it sparked endless quarters and rivalries. The competitive scene it created still influences fighting games today.

1. Mortal Kombat II (1993)
This sequel perfected the formula. Better graphics, more characters, and the infamous fatalities made it a phenomenon. The digitized actors and brutal finishing moves drew huge crowds, and the controversy over its violence only made it more popular. It remains the defining arcade game of the 1990s.
